Skip to content

Mid Data Engineer Salary in Amsterdam (2026)

€72,000 – €92,000 gross/year

Salary distribution (p10 – p90)

€62kmedian €82k€100k

Source: LinkedIn Salary, Glassdoor, Levels.fyi, Robert Half Tech Salary Guide. Updated May 2026.

About 50 people in Netherlands search for “data engineer salary” each month.

Reviewed by the Talenture hiring team, May 2026. Updated quarterly.

How we calculate these ranges

Ranges are aggregated from LinkedIn Salary, Glassdoor, Levels.fyi, and the Robert Half Tech Salary Guide, covering 500+ reported salaries per role. Percentiles are based on publicly reported gross annual figures for the Netherlands market. Data is reviewed and updated quarterly. Talenture works directly with hiring teams across Netherlands to benchmark these figures against active offers.

See how your CV compares to the skills Amsterdam companies are hiring for.

Check your CV against the Amsterdam market

Mid Data Engineer salary breakdown in Amsterdam

Total compensation

78,000-110,000 EUR total compensation including base, performance bonus, and equity

Bonus and equity

Booking.com and Adyen offer 10-15% annual bonuses plus RSUs for mid data engineers. Scale-ups offer 0.04-0.15% equity options. Analytics engineering roles at product companies may include hybrid bonuses tied to data quality and platform uptime metrics.

Pay by company type

Company typeSalary range
Enterprise (Booking.com, Adyen, TomTom)76,000-90,000 EUR
Scale-up (bol.com, Mollie, Coolblue)78,000-92,000 EUR
Data startup72,000-84,000 EUR + equity

Salary by years of experience

ExperienceTypical gross salary
0-2 years€62,000€72,000
3-5 years€72,000€82,000
6-10 years€82,000€90,000
10+ years€90,000€100,000

Derived from the p10-p90 salary distribution for this role, city, and seniority band.

Tax and take-home in Netherlands

At 82,000 EUR gross, Dutch income tax is approximately 40-44%. The 30% ruling for eligible expats reduces taxable income substantially, bringing effective tax closer to 30-32%.

Estimated net take-home at median gross: ~48,000/year (approx. 4,000/month) for Dutch nationals; ~58,000/year with 30% ruling for eligible expats

Year-on-year change

Mid-level data engineer salaries in Amsterdam rose 7-9% from 2025, driven by the growth of analytics engineering as a distinct specialisation and increased investment in real-time data infrastructure.

Cost of living: Amsterdam vs Berlin and London

A gross salary figure only tells part of the story. The table below shows what your Amsterdam median gross of €82,000 is worth in purchasing-power terms across linked cities.

CityCoL vs AmsterdamEquivalent salary needed
Amsterdam (this page)baseline€82,000
Berlin24% cheaper62,000
London18% more expensive£82,000*

* Cross-currency estimate at 1 GBP = 1.18 EUR. Actual purchasing power varies with exchange rates.

Cost of living index: Numbeo, Q1 2026. “Equivalent salary needed” = what you would need to earn in that city to maintain the same lifestyle as your Amsterdam median salary.

What drives Data Engineer salary in Amsterdam

  • 1

    Mid-level data engineers in Amsterdam with 3-5 years of experience earn 72,000-92,000 EUR, with Booking.com's data platform team and Adyen's analytics engineering group at the upper end for engineers who own high-traffic production pipelines.

  • 2

    Analytics engineers (data engineers who work directly with dbt and BI tools alongside backend pipelines) command 80,000-88,000 EUR at Amsterdam product companies: the role bridges data engineering and analytics and is specifically valued.

  • 3

    Engineers with real-time streaming experience (Kafka, Flink, Spark Streaming) earn 85,000-92,000 EUR at Amsterdam's FinTech and logistics companies where event-time processing is operationally critical.

  • 4

    The 30% ruling for eligible expat hires drives Amsterdam companies to offer 80,000-90,000 EUR for data engineers relocating from London, maintaining competitive net take-home parity.

Skills that command a premium for Data Engineers in Amsterdam

  • dbt + advanced analytics engineering (models, tests, documentation at scale)

    Amsterdam product teams running hundreds of dbt models need mid engineers who can architect dbt projects, not just write models; this senior dbt competency at mid level earns 86,000-92,000 EUR.

  • Kafka or Apache Flink for streaming data pipelines

    Amsterdam FinTechs and logistics companies processing real-time events need mid engineers who can design and maintain streaming architectures; this is the highest-premium mid-level data skill in the city.

  • Databricks or Spark for large-scale batch processing

    Booking.com and bol.com run Spark-based batch pipelines at massive scale; mid engineers certified on Databricks or with production Spark experience command 82,000-90,000 EUR.

  • Data modelling (dimensional modelling, data vault, OBT patterns)

    Amsterdam companies maturing their data platforms need mid engineers who can design stable, performant data models rather than ad-hoc pipeline approaches; modelling expertise is consistently underhired.

  • Python (PySpark, asyncio, custom Airflow operators)

    Advanced Python for data engineering (beyond pandas and basic scripts) is required for mid-level roles at Amsterdam's most demanding data platforms.

Hiring market context: Data Engineers in Amsterdam

Mid-level data engineer demand in Amsterdam is strong at Booking.com, Adyen, bol.com, and a growing cluster of data-first scale-ups (DataSnipper, Tiqets). Most roles require 3+ years of production pipeline experience and strong dbt and cloud data warehouse skills. Interview processes typically include a data modelling scenario and a live SQL or Python exercise.

Amsterdam companies are hiring for these exact skills right now. See how your CV stacks up.

Check your CV against the Amsterdam market

Mid Data Engineer salary in Amsterdam: frequently asked questions

What is the mid-level data engineer salary in Amsterdam in 2026?

Mid-level data engineers in Amsterdam with 3-5 years of experience earn 72,000-92,000 EUR gross per year. The median is around 82,000 EUR. Booking.com and Adyen pay at the upper end; earlier-stage startups at the lower end.

What is the difference between a data engineer and an analytics engineer in Amsterdam?

Analytics engineers focus on the transformation layer (dbt models, BI tool delivery) and work more closely with business stakeholders, while data engineers focus on pipeline infrastructure (ingestion, orchestration, storage). In Amsterdam's data market, analytics engineers typically earn 78,000-88,000 EUR at mid level, similar to data engineers but at product-led companies.

Is Kafka experience valuable for data engineers in Amsterdam?

Yes. Kafka expertise for real-time streaming pipelines is the highest-premium mid-level skill for data engineers in Amsterdam, commanding 85,000-92,000 EUR at FinTech and logistics companies. It is less commonly required than dbt or Airflow, making it a strong differentiator.

Is 82,000 EUR a good mid-level data engineer salary in Amsterdam?

Yes. 82,000 EUR is approximately the 50th percentile for mid-level data engineers in Amsterdam. Engineers with Kafka or Databricks experience can reach 88,000-92,000 EUR at Amsterdam's most data-intensive employers.